In the event that you decide to use not a double housing, but a dual version (do not be confused, now you will understand why), connecting the wires will look different. Double sockets (they can also be called assembled sockets) are two separate electrical points located in adjacent grooves and interconnected by jumpers (loops).

The connection diagram for double sockets with grounding looks like this:

If your house has a two-wire network (without ground), then in this case the connection of dual sockets should be carried out according to the diagram without grounding:

Please note that jumpers can only be used if not very powerful electrical appliances will be connected to the electrical points. Otherwise, you need to create for each product from distribution box.

Connection diagram for single-key socket-switch unit

Before the advent of combined socket-switch units, each element was installed separately, which complicated not only the connection diagram, but also the operating time. Of course, separate connections have their advantages. But thanks to its design, the combined block helps achieve high efficiency and ease of use.

The installation of the device is also simplified (no need to lay extra wires and drill additional niches for socket boxes). The disadvantage of such units is the impossibility of replacing an individual element (if a socket or switch fails, the entire device will need to be replaced).

Connection tools:

  • Pliers;
  • Assembly or stationery knife;
  • Screwdrivers.

To connect the unit with grounding, you will need a cable with four cores. First, we install the cable and socket box into the wall. We insert the wire into the electrical outlet and distribution box and strip the ends. Now the phase (black or white) wire and the neutral (usually blue) wire need to be connected to the side terminals of the socket with sockets, and the ground wire (yellow-green) to the central terminal. We connect the remaining wire to the switch terminal.

Be sure to make sure that all wires in the block and junction box are connected correctly. It is unacceptable to connect two contacts with different polarities.

We connect the wires in the junction box. We connect the phase wire going to the socket with the phase of the power cable. We also connect the neutral wire from the outlet and the neutral going to the lighting fixture (chandelier or lamp) to the neutral of the power cable. We connect the phase wire from the switch to the phase going to the lighting fixture. We screw the front part of the block.

If you do not use clamp terminals when connecting wires in the junction box, securely insulate the exposed contacts with electrical tape.

New socket box for double socket

You should pay close attention to the quality of the new socket - it should be high enough, and in this case you can be sure of clear fixation and normal operation of the socket.

The socket box is secured to the wall with side holders, which are sold separately or come in one set. Cheaper socket boxes are attached not with special claws, but with screws.

The procedure for mounting a socket box is simple. The screws on it need to be tightened clockwise, the holders will move apart to the right and left, securing the product itself. But as you work, the glass always weakens, so best option- additionally secure it with alabaster.

Instructions for action:

  1. Dilute dry alabaster powder (you can replace it with cement) to the consistency of sour cream. You need to take a small portion of the powder, since the composition instantly hardens.
  2. Place the mixture in the place of the future socket box, slightly wetting the niche with water.
  3. After 20 minutes, you can attach the socket box to the hole in the wall.
  4. Level the position of the glass using a hammer and level so that it is perfectly level.
  5. Next, fill the gaps between the product and the wall with a new portion of alabaster.
  6. Remove excess mass with a knife.
  7. Secure the glass with screws, making sure not to tighten them too much - this could cause the plastic to crack.

A double or dual socket is a monoblock consisting of two plug connectors for connecting plugs of electrical appliances, which is installed in one seat (in one socket) and requires a standard set of wires for connection - phase, working zero and ground (protective zero).

Double sockets are used most often in cases where a single socket is no longer enough to connect several consumers, and for some reason it is not possible to add another socket. You need to use such sockets with extreme caution, monitor the power of the devices connected to it so that their total current does not exceed 10A-16A (depending on the characteristics of the specific model of the dual socket).

Connecting a double socket Let's look at the example of Schneider Electric mechanisms of the Sedna model.

1. Turn off the electricity! To do this in the electrical panel, you need levers circuit breakers switch to the “off” state, usually this is the position in which the lever is pointing down. Which machine needs to be turned off, if they are not signed, is determined empirically by turning them off one by one and checking, for example with an indicator screwdriver, for the presence of voltage in the socket wiring. As a last resort, turn everything off. But then be sure to make sure that there is no electric current, at the installation location!

2. We disassemble the socket; to do this, unscrew the mounting screws using a screwdriver, as shown in the image below. As a result of this, we separate the front panel from the double socket mechanism.

3. Using pliers or side cutters, shorten the wires in the socket so that their length is approximately 10cm. Then we remove 8-10mm of insulation from the ends, and, for ease of connection, we bend the wires as shown below.

4. Place the wires into the screw terminals of the dual socket mechanism, the location of which is indicated in the image below. We place the phase wire (we have brown) and the working zero (we have blue) in different outer terminals, and the protective zero - ground (we have yellow-green) in the central one. And use a screwdriver to tighten the screws.

5. Having leveled the double socket mechanism, we fix it in the socket box using fastening screws located on the sides (see figure below).

6. Last step- This is the installation of the front panel. We apply it to the mechanism already fixed in the wall and tighten the fastening screws. Be careful not to overtighten them as the bezel may collapse.

7. We turn on all the machines in the electrical panel and test the operation of the double socket. Installation is complete.
